Have each of the points necessary before beginning to undress the infant.

An toddler immediately loses physique warmth, so it is crucial the home is heat and there are no drafts from open Home windows or doorways. A wall thermometer is useful. A bathinette or maybe a plastic tub three-quarters brimming with lukewarm water need to be put in just arm's length. Also needed are a small bowl of warm h2o through which There exists a squirt of liquid tub cleaning soap; two little sponges; cotton balls; cotton swabs; disposable wipes; infant oil; cleaning soap; shampoo; lotion; talcum powder; a wonderful-toothed comb; a bristle hairbrush; plus a child comb. A waterproof apron is additionally needed, preferably one particular using a Turkish toweling area, together with several delicate, absorbent towels for patting the newborn dry; a refreshing diaper; diaper pins; plastic trousers; in addition to a list of thoroughly clean dresses.

New child toddlers heartily dislike encounter-cloths. Until finally the infant is one thirty day period previous, use moistened cotton balls or disposable wipes to wash their facial area. Afterward, use among the sponges for the experience and the second sponge to the buttocks location when a soiled diaper is eliminated.

Most toddlers have diaper rash at just one time or An additional, normally attributable to extended contact with stools and urine. A medical professional will recommend an ointment to get rid of the rash. Diaper rash can ordinarily be prevented by spreading on somewhat petroleum jelly within the diaper location following the child's bathtub, and by checking the newborn's diapers typically and modifying them when necessary to stay clear of prolonged connection with urine and stool.

Dry pores and skin is common among new child infants. Baby oil, gently massaged in the skin, can minimize the condition. But check the oil initial on the child's ankle to be sure that There's not an allergic reaction.

Cradle cap, a patch of yellowish, greasy crusting on the newborn's head, ought to be handled at bathtub time. Once the child is nursed, therapeutic massage some oil in to the scalp and depart it for several hrs right up until another meal. By then the scaling really should be straightforward to elevate that has a fantastic-toothed comb. At bath time, shampoo and rinse the newborn's scalp and dry very carefully. Brush the baby's hair.

In the course of bathtub time reassure the infant by speaking softly. A newborn infant is frightened by loud noises and swift, jerky actions and responds by crying.

Tackle the infant gently when dressing him or her. Toddlers A lot prefer being undressed.

Garments needs to be basic to slide on and choose off as the baby might be crying and perhaps stiff and rigid from exertion. Free clothing with snap fasteners are preferable to outfits that needs to be pulled around The top.

The Tub. Within the early months, bathtub-time may possibly consider for a longer time than anticipated for the reason that the two father or mother and baby don't know pretty what to expect. When a regime is recognized, the child will experience more secure and tolerant Dr. Madre Thermometer of dealing with.

Make sure in these early times which the home and bath temperatures are saved consistent throughout the tub-time. For the initial six months, the temperature in the area really should be 70-75 Fahrenheit levels (21-24 Celsius levels). Just after six weeks it could then be 65-70 Fahrenheit degrees (eighteen-21 Celsius degrees). The bathwater should be saved at a hundred-104 Fahrenheit degrees (37-forty Celsius degrees), slightly bigger than regular human body temperature. Keep a pitcher of heat water close to the tub to top rated from the bathwater should it amazing down too much.

Be form to the child; cope with her or him with warm hands; speak softly in a calming voice.

Most infants enjoy staying inside the h2o, but loathe popping out of it; they cry, displaying signs of insecurity and shivering. The child needs to be wrapped quickly in a towel and held tightly to get a moment. This helps a toddler to chill out once more. Now bit by bit start to dry the child, either in your lap or on the altering mat. Ensure that a soft, absorbent towel covers the plastic mat before you lay the child on it. Now gently open the towel during which the child is wrapped and pat dry which has a 2nd towel. Usually try to maintain included the areas of your body that are not really getting dried.

In the event the child is dry, you could possibly implement ointment towards the diaper place if you want, and after that begin to costume the infant. Place over the undershirt initially to help keep your body warm, then the diaper, and finally the nightgown. All of this time, the infant could possibly be impatient being nursed. But tend not to Allow loud issues distract you from what you're carrying out.
